Description:
Python WebDAV implementation (level 1 and 2) that features a library that enables you to integrate WebDAV server capabilities to your application. WebDAV is an extension to the normal HTTP/1.1 protocol allowing the user to upload data, create collections of objects, store properties for objects, etc. WWW: http://www.webdav.de/

Convert Python ports to FLAVORS.

  Ports using USE_PYTHON=distutils are now flavored.  They will
  automatically get flavors (py27, py34, py35, py36) depending on what
  versions they support.

  There is also a USE_PYTHON=flavors for ports that do not use distutils
  but need FLAVORS to be set.  A USE_PYTHON=noflavors can be set if
  using distutils but flavors are not wanted.

  A new USE_PYTHON=optsuffix that will add PYTHON_PKGNAMESUFFIX has been
  added to cope with Python ports that did not have the Python
  PKGNAMEPREFIX but are flavored.

  USES=python now also exports a PY_FLAVOR variable that contains the
